The Role of a Dissertation Proposal

A dissertation proposal serves as a roadmap for your research journey. It outlines the scope, objectives, and methodology of your study, helping you organize your thoughts and ideas before diving into the extensive research and writing process (Abramson, 2015). Here’s why a strong dissertation proposal is essential:

  1. Clarity of Direction: A well-defined proposal articulates the purpose and direction of your research. It highlights the research questions you intend to address and provides a clear overview of the study’s goals.
  2. Feasibility Assessment: Through the proposal, you can assess the feasibility of your research. It allows you to identify any potential roadblocks or limitations in advance, giving you the opportunity to make necessary adjustments.
  3. Feedback and Guidance: Submitting your proposal to your advisors and peers opens the door to valuable feedback. Constructive criticism at this stage can refine your research approach and improve the overall quality of your dissertation.
  4. Time and Resource Management: A detailed proposal helps you plan the resources and time needed for your research. It ensures that you allocate your efforts efficiently and avoid unnecessary detours (helpwithdissertation, 2021).
  5. Ethical Considerations: Addressing ethical concerns in your proposal demonstrates your commitment to conducting responsible research. Ethical considerations could involve issues such as participant consent, data privacy, and research integrity.

Components of an Effective Dissertation Proposal

let’s delve into each of these components of an effective dissertation proposal in more detail:

1. Title and Introduction

The title of your dissertation proposal should succinctly capture the essence of your research. It should be clear, concise, and reflective of the main focus of your study. The introduction section should provide context for your research by discussing the background of the topic and explaining why it’s important. Consider addressing the gap in knowledge that your study aims to fill. This section serves as the foundation for the rest of your proposal, setting the stage for what follows.

2. Research Objectives and Questions

Clearly articulate the research objectives you intend to achieve through your study. These objectives should be spec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ART). Next, outline the research questions that you aim to answer. These questions guide your research and serve as the core inquiries you’ll address in your study. Ensure that your research questions align with your objectives and contribute to fulfilling the overall purpose of your research.

3. Literature Review

The literature review establishes the context of your research by reviewing existing scholarly works relevant to your topic. Identify key theories, concepts, and studies that are related to your research. Highlight gaps, inconsistencies, or areas where further investigation is needed. Discuss how your research will contribute to filling these gaps and advancing the field. This section demonstrates your understanding of the existing literature and your ability to position your study within a broader academic context.

4. Methodology

In this section, describe the research methods you plan to use to gather and analyze data. Explain whether you’ll be conducting qualitative, quantitative, or mixed-methods research. Detail the data collection techniques, such as surveys, interviews, experiments, or observations. Discuss your sampling strategy and explain how you’ll ensure the reliability and validity of your data. Justify your chosen methodology by explaining why it’s the most appropriate approach for your research objectives. Additionally, mention any ethical considerations you’ve taken into account when designing your research methods.

5. Significance and Contribution

Articulate the significance of your research within both the academic and practical realms. Explain how your study fills gaps in the existing literature and addresses relevant issues. Discuss the potential implications of your findings for your field and beyond. Emphasize how your research could lead to practical applications, policy recommendations, or further investigations. This section demonstrates your awareness of the broader impact of your work and its potential to advance knowledge.

6. Timeline and Resources

Provide a detailed timeline that outlines the different phases of your research, from literature review to data collection and analysis, and finally to writing the dissertation. Break down the tasks and allocate time for each stage. This timeline demonstrates your ability to plan and manage your research efficiently. Additionally, detail the resources you’ll require, such as access to libraries, databases, research tools, equipment, and software. If your research involves human subjects, mention the ethical considerations and approvals you’ll need to secure.

7. Bibliography

Include a comprehensive list of references you’ve consulted during the proposal writing process. This showcases your engagement with existing literature and demonstrates that your research is built upon a solid foundation of knowledge. Follow the appropriate citation style (such as APA, MLA, or Chicago) and ensure that all sources are properly formatted.
